Quick attach systems have revolutionized the way operators interact with heavy equipment. Originally developed in the mid-20th century for skid steers and compact loaders, these mechanisms allowed for rapid switching between buckets, forks, grapples, augers, and other tools without manual pinning or extensive downtime. By the 1990s, quick attach technology had expanded to excavators, backhoes, and even large wheel loaders.
The concept was born out of necessity. Construction sites, farms, and forestry operations demanded versatility. Instead of dedicating a machine to a single task, quick attach systems enabled multi-functionality. This shift dramatically improved equipment utilization rates and reduced idle time.
Types of Quick Attach Systems
There are several dominant quick attach formats in use today:
- Universal Skid Steer Mount (SSQA)
Common across most compact loaders, this system uses two locking levers and a standardized plate. It’s compatible with a wide range of attachments from different manufacturers.
- Euro/Global Mount
Popular in agricultural loaders, especially in Europe. It features horizontal pins and a spring-loaded locking mechanism.
- Pin-on Systems
Traditional method requiring manual removal of pins. Still used in older machines or for high-torque applications.
- Hydraulic Couplers
Found on excavators and large loaders. These allow operators to switch attachments from the cab using hydraulic controls.
- Tiltrotators
Advanced systems that rotate and tilt attachments, offering unmatched flexibility for grading, trenching, and landscaping.
- Coupler: A device that connects the attachment to the machine’s arm or boom.
- SSQA: Skid Steer Quick Attach, a standardized mounting system.
- Tiltrotator: A hydraulic device that allows attachments to rotate 360° and tilt up to 45°, enhancing precision.
- Time Savings
Switching attachments can take less than 30 seconds with hydraulic couplers, compared to 10–15 minutes manually.
- Improved Safety
Operators remain in the cab, reducing exposure to pinch points and unstable terrain.
- Increased Productivity
Machines can perform multiple tasks in a single shift, reducing the need for additional equipment.
- Reduced Labor Costs
Fewer personnel are needed to assist with attachment changes.
- Enhanced Equipment Utilization
One machine can serve as a loader, trencher, sweeper, or forklift depending on the attachment.
Despite the advantages, quick attach systems are not without drawbacks:
- Attachment Compatibility
Not all attachments fit all couplers. Manufacturers may use proprietary designs, leading to confusion and limited interchangeability.
- Wear and Tear
Frequent switching can accelerate wear on coupler pins, bushings, and locking mechanisms.
- Hydraulic Complexity
Attachments requiring auxiliary hydraulics may need additional plumbing, valves, or electrical connections.
- Cost
Hydraulic couplers and tiltrotators can cost upwards of $10,000, making them a significant investment.

Industry Trends and News
In 2023, a Swedish manufacturer introduced a universal tiltrotator adapter compatible with both ISO and proprietary couplers. This innovation aimed to reduce attachment incompatibility across brands.
Meanwhile, rental companies have begun offering quick attach packages, allowing customers to rent a base machine with multiple attachments. This model has gained traction in urban construction zones where space and time are limited.
Technical Recommendations
To maximize the benefits of quick attach systems:
- Standardize your fleet with compatible couplers
- Invest in high-quality locking mechanisms with wear-resistant materials
- Schedule regular inspections of pins, bushings, and hydraulic lines
- Train operators on proper attachment procedures and safety protocols
- Use color-coded hydraulic couplers to prevent misconnection
